Subject: preventing endnotes from running off the page
Date: Mon, 6 Aug 2018 00:54:27 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1BB1A1BE-628E-4D2A-B27F-10ABD7BB6A75@zydenbos.net> (raw)

When using endnotes, it seems that all the notes that are collected in the text are placed together in a frame – but I have so many notes in a chapter that the frame runs off the last page.

Is there any way to let the endnotes run on naturally to the next page?
